Die Gründe und Lösungen dafür, dass die Einrückung der ersten CSS-Zeile keine Auswirkung hat: 1. Das Element ist kein Element auf Blockebene. Die Lösung besteht darin, „display:inline-block;“ zu verwenden Attribute einiger Elemente auf Blockebene. 2. Der Effekt wird blockiert. Bei Stilüberschreibungen mit höherer Priorität besteht die Lösung darin, die Priorität zu ändern.
Die Betriebsumgebung dieses Tutorials: Windows 7-System, CSS3-Version. Diese Methode ist für alle Computermarken geeignet.
Empfehlung: „css-Video-Tutorial“
Im Webseitenlayout ist das Einrücken der ersten Zeile ein sehr häufiger Effekt. Dadurch sehen Ihre Absätze standardisierter und aufgeräumter aus! Manchmal wird der Einzug der ersten Zeile über CSS festgelegt, hat aber keine Auswirkung. Was ist der Grund?
Der Einzug der ersten Zeile in CSS verwendet das Attribut text-indent, und sein Wert ermöglicht die Verwendung von Zahlen, Prozentsätzen und die Vererbung.
Der Grund, warum die Einrückung der ersten CSS-Zeile ungültig ist: Das
-Element ist kein Element auf Blockebene
Der Effekt wird durch einen Stil mit höherer Priorität überschrieben.
Lösung:
1. Bestimmen Sie, ob es sich bei dem Tag um ein Element auf Blockebene handelt. Wenn nicht, können Sie es mit den Attributen einiger Elemente auf Blockebene versehen. Überprüfen Sie, ob es ungültig ist, da es sich um ein !important Question-Prioritäts-Tag handelt bedeutet relative Textgröße, 1em ist 1 Textgröße, 2em sind zwei Textgrößen)
Das obige ist der detaillierte Inhalt vonWarum hat die Einrückung der ersten CSS-Zeile keine Auswirkung?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!